Acceptance and Commitment Therapy I
Printed in the catalogue as ACCEPTANCE AND COMMITMENT THERAPY I
Course content
In-depth introduction to acceptance and commitment therapy (ACT) as a contemporary approach within third-wave psychotherapies; the psychological flexibility model; acceptance, cognitive defusion, present-moment awareness, self-as-context, values, committed action. Foundational and contemporary ACT literature; theoretical foundations and core principles of ACT.
